Output d15a1bea5b3fd3dbaccfcdc1b3f25094de84df1dc20de5cd93a99b6ad33e0944:1

value
4021569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0b3884f0b7fbe792581f7d77880ba6c039c400b OP_EQUAL
address
3PdjAiXYWUcbMQevNGPLKUqDDbNQCaQrdV
transaction
d15a1bea5b3fd3dbaccfcdc1b3f25094de84df1dc20de5cd93a99b6ad33e0944
confirmations
319952
spent
true